- Franco frankitoAug 27, 2024 · a year agoYes, you can use cryptocurrency with Chase Bank. However, there are some restrictions and limitations that you need to be aware of. Firstly, Chase Bank does not directly support cryptocurrency transactions. This means that you cannot buy or sell cryptocurrencies directly through your Chase Bank account. However, you can still use your Chase Bank account to transfer funds to and from cryptocurrency exchanges. Additionally, Chase Bank may impose certain restrictions on cryptocurrency-related transactions, such as limiting the amount of money you can transfer or requiring additional verification for cryptocurrency-related transactions. It's important to check with Chase Bank directly to understand their specific policies and restrictions on using cryptocurrency.
